SUDOSCAN+检测2型糖尿病患者心血管疾病发生风险研究及影响因素分析 被引量:3

Prediction and influencing factors of SUDOSCAN+on the risk of cardiovascular disease in patients with type 2 diabetes mellitus

摘要 目的评估SUDOSCAN+检测对T2DM患者心血管疾病的预测价值并探讨糖尿病心血管自主神经病变(DCAN)的影响因素。方法选取2016年12月至2017年12月于哈尔滨市第一医院内分泌科住院的T2DM患者200例,根据SUDOSCAN+检测结果分为DCAN风险≥50%组(HR组)和DCAN风险<50%组(LR组),每组各100例。比较两组相关指标,统计随访12个月心血管事件发生情况。结果与LR组比较,HR组HbA_(1)c、TG及DPN患病率升高,HDL-C降低(P<0.05)。HR组心血管事件发生率高于LR组(53%vs 27%,P<0.001)。Logistic回归分析结果显示,年龄、BMI、HbA_(1c)是DCAN的影响因素。结论年龄、BMI、HbA_(1)c是T2DM患者DCAN的影响因素,SUDOSCAN+检测对T2DM患者心血管疾病有临床预测价值。 Objective To evaluate the predictive value of SUDOSCAN+for cardiovascular disease in patients with type 2 diabetes mellitus(T2DM)and explore the influencing factors of diabetic cardiovascular autonomic neuropathy(DCAN).Methods 200 T2DM patients hospitalized in the Endocrinology Department of Harbin First Hospital from December 2016 to December 2017 were selected.According to the SUDOSCAN+test results,they were divided into DCAN risk≥50%group(HR group,n=100)and DCAN risk<50%group(LR group,n=100).The related indexes of the two groups were compared and the incidence of cardiovascular events during the 12-month follow-up was analyzed.Results Compared with LR group,the levels of HbA_(1)c and TG and the prevalence of DPN were higher in HR group,and the level of HDL-C was lower(P<0.05).The incidence of cardiovascular events in HR group was higher than that in LR group(53%vs 27%,P<0.001).Logistic regression analysis showed that age,BMI and HbA_(1)c were the influencing factors of DCAN.Conclusion Age,BMI and HbA_(1)c are the influencing factors of DCAN in T2DM patients.SUDOSCAN+detection has clinical predictive value for cardiovascular disease in T2DM patients.
